Preview List (Over 10000 Tables)

Hello,


I have the following issue:

When I retrieve data through SQL Server, i exceed the preview list of tables due to many tenants in my SQL/NAV-Database, reaching over 10000. This means I cannot find tables from the lower tenants using the search function of the navigator.

Example

 

As a workaround, i use the advanced editor, but I would like to filter the list beforehand.

Question:
Is it possible to restrict the tenants/tables when connecting to the database? SQL?


Does anyone have experience with this issue or has it been implemented a solution before? How else could one solve this problem?
